Hana Launches Product Council to Address Needs of Office Tenants
Hana, a New York-based subsidiary of CBRE, launched a new product council, Hana Innovation Partners (HIP), intended to address evolving needs from both tenants and employees in the current and post-COVID-19 eras. The council includes representatives from top companies such as Samsung, Herman Miller, Structure Tone and Muraflex.
Recent research commissioned by Hana points to a growing need for both more flexibility from employees to work outside the office, at least part time, and a place to meet with colleagues for in-person interactions. The HIP council will create a guide that outlines a range of solutions for safe and productive meetings in the COVID-19 era, and plans to issue the guide later this year.
“We’re eager for the HIP program to develop solutions that increase safety and team performance while inspiring employees to once again meet face-to-face with their colleagues,” said Andrew Kao, VP of product, Hana.
